物件檢測系統(tǒng)的制作方法
【技術(shù)領(lǐng)域】
[0001] 本發(fā)明是有關(guān)于一種物件檢測系統(tǒng),且特別是有關(guān)于一種移動物件檢測系統(tǒng)。
【背景技術(shù)】
[0002] 隨著汽車銷售量不斷地成長,車用電子產(chǎn)業(yè)也蓬勃發(fā)展,其中車用電子產(chǎn)業(yè)包含 了車用安全系統(tǒng)、車身系統(tǒng)、駕駛信息系統(tǒng)、息吊底盤系統(tǒng)、引擎?zhèn)鲃酉到y(tǒng)、保全系統(tǒng)等六大 方面,而其又W車用安全系統(tǒng)的年復(fù)合成長率為最高。
[0003] 然而,在汽車數(shù)量日益增長之下,發(fā)生道路事故的機率也逐年增加。根據(jù)統(tǒng)計資料 顯示,駕駛員只要在發(fā)生碰撞的0. 5砂前得到預(yù)警,即可W避免至少60%的追尾撞車事故、 30%的迎面撞車事故和50%的路面相關(guān)事故,而若有1砂鐘的預(yù)警時間,則可避免90%的 事故。因此,車用安全系統(tǒng)的重要性可見一斑。
[0004] 隨著圖像設(shè)備成本大幅降低W及電腦圖像辨識技術(shù)日新月異,W電腦圖像為主的 車輛與行人警示技術(shù)已成為主要研究方向。此類的技術(shù)主要是在車上安裝基于電腦視覺的 檢測系統(tǒng),在車輛行駛中連續(xù)拍攝圖像,再W圖像處理、電腦視覺、及圖形辨識等技術(shù)檢測 路面、路邊、其他行進中車輛、行人等靜態(tài)與動態(tài)信息,進而準確地感測出環(huán)境狀況,W提供 駕駛員更多的行車信息。
[0005] 基于電腦視覺的檢測系統(tǒng)具有多樣性應(yīng)用、經(jīng)濟、及使用彈性等優(yōu)點。然而,對于 各種圖像處理的演算法而言,其檢測的準確度W及效能有所差異。因此,如何提供一種高準 確率且高效能的檢測系統(tǒng)實為本領(lǐng)域技術(shù)人員所關(guān)也的議題之一。
【發(fā)明內(nèi)容】
[0006] 本發(fā)明提供一種物件檢測系統(tǒng),其可精確并且實時地檢測視頻串流中的移動物 件。
[0007]本發(fā)明提供一種物件檢測系統(tǒng),包括存儲單元、圖像獲取模塊、特征搜尋模塊、計 算模塊W及確認模塊。存儲單元用W存儲至少包含多張圖像的視頻串流。圖像獲取模塊, 禪接存儲單元,用W自存儲單元讀取視頻串流中對應(yīng)于第一時間點的第一圖像、對應(yīng)于第 二時間點的第二圖像W及對應(yīng)于第H時間點的第H圖像,其中第一時間點與第二時間點的 時間差小于或等于第二時間點與第H時間點的時間差。特征搜尋模塊用W自第一圖像中搜 尋至少一個特征點。計算模塊用W判斷所述特征點位于近距離的檢測區(qū)域或是遠距離的檢 測區(qū)域。當所述特征點位于近距離的檢測區(qū)域時,計算模塊根據(jù)第一圖像W及第二圖像,計 算各所述特征點的移動向量;當所述特征點位于遠距離的檢測區(qū)域時,計算模塊根據(jù)第一 圖像與第二圖像其中之一者W及第H圖像,計算各所述特征點的移動向量。確認模塊用W 根據(jù)各所述特征點的移動向量,確認移動物件是否存在。
[0008] 在本發(fā)明的一實施例中,上述的特征搜尋模塊所搜尋的所述特征點為一個1x1畫 素或多個畫素所構(gòu)成。
[0009] 在本發(fā)明的一實施例中,上述的計算模塊是利用多個像素特征比對法或是光流法 計算各所述特征點的移動向量。
[0010] 在本發(fā)明的一實施例中,上述的計算模塊根據(jù)各所述特征點的移動向量,計算各 所述特征點的位移,從而計算各所述特征點的移動速度,并且確認模塊判斷各所述特征點 的移動速度是否大于與各特征點距離有關(guān)的速度口檻值。當確認模塊判斷至少一所述特征 點的移動速度大于速度口檻值時,確認模塊確認移動物件存在。
[0011] 本發(fā)明提供另一種物件檢測系統(tǒng),包括存儲單元、圖像獲取模塊、特征搜尋模塊、 計算模塊W及確認模塊。存儲單元用W存儲至少包含多張圖像的視頻串流。圖像獲取模塊, 禪接存儲單元,用W自存儲單元讀取視頻串流中對應(yīng)于第一時間點的第一圖像、對應(yīng)于第 二時間點的第二圖像、對應(yīng)于第H時間點的第H圖像W及對應(yīng)于第四時間點的第四圖像, 其中第一時間點與第二時間點的時間差小于或等于第H時間點與第四時間點的時間差。特 征搜尋模塊用W自第一圖像中搜尋至少一個特征點。計算模塊用W判斷所述特征點位于近 距離的檢測區(qū)域或是遠距離的檢測區(qū)域。當所述特征點位于近距離的檢測區(qū)域時,計算模 塊根據(jù)第一圖像W及第二圖像,計算各所述特征點的移動向量;當所述特征點位于遠距離 的檢測區(qū)域時,計算模塊根據(jù)第H圖像與第四圖像,計算各所述特征點的移動向量。確認模 塊用W根據(jù)各所述特征點的移動向量,確認移動物件是否存在。
[0012] 在本發(fā)明的一實施例中,上述的特征搜尋模塊所搜尋的所述特征點為一個1x1畫 素或多個畫素所構(gòu)成。
[0013] 在本發(fā)明的一實施例中,上述的計算模塊是利用多個像素特征比對法或是光流法 計算各所述特征點的移動向量。
[0014] 在本發(fā)明的一實施例中,上述的計算模塊根據(jù)各所述特征點的移動向量,計算各 所述特征點的位移,從而計算各所述特征點的移動速度,并且確認模塊判斷各所述特征點 的移動速度是否大于與各特征點距離有關(guān)的速度口檻值。當確認模塊判斷至少一所述特征 點的移動速度大于速度口檻值時,確認模塊確認移動物件存在。
[0015] 基于上述,本發(fā)明所提供的物件檢測系統(tǒng),其利用視頻串流中不同的圖像來計算 特征點的移動向量。當特征點位于遠近距離的檢測區(qū)域時,利用時間差較小的兩張圖像來 計算特征點的移動向量,W縮短物件檢測的時間;當特征點位于遠距離的檢測區(qū)域時,利用 時間差較大的兩張圖像來計算特征點的移動向量,W提高物件檢測的準確率。除此之外,本 發(fā)明還通過特征點的移動向量,計算特征點的位移,從而計算特征點的移動速度,W確認移 動物件的存在?;?,本發(fā)明的物件檢測系統(tǒng)可更精確地掌握移動物件的信息,并且可達到 實時圖像處理的效能,W運用于低成本的消費性電子產(chǎn)品上,增強本發(fā)明在實際應(yīng)用中的 適用性。
[0016] 為讓本發(fā)明的上述特征和優(yōu)點能更明顯易懂,下文特舉實施例,并配合附圖作詳 細說明如下。
【附圖說明】
[0017] 圖1是根據(jù)本發(fā)明一實施例所示出的物件檢測系統(tǒng)的方塊圖;
[0018] 圖2是依照本發(fā)明第一實施例所示出的物件檢測方法的流程圖;
[0019] 圖3A是根據(jù)本發(fā)明一實施例所示出的第一圖像的示意圖;
[0020] 圖3B是根據(jù)本發(fā)明一實施例所示出的物件檢測方法中步驟S209的示意圖;
[0021] 圖4是依照本發(fā)明第二實施例所示出的物件檢測方法的流程圖。
[002引附圖標記說明:
[002引 100 ;物件檢測系統(tǒng);
[0024] 110;存儲單元;
[00幼120;圖像獲取模塊;
[002引 130 ;特征搜尋模塊;
[0027] 140 ;計算模塊;
[002引 150 ;確認模塊;
[0029]S201~S211、S401~S411 ;物件檢測方法的流程;
[0030] 30 ;物件;
[003U 310;第一圖像;
[003引320 ;第二圖像;
[003引330 :第立圖像;
[0034] 312、332;遠距離的檢測區(qū)域;
[00巧]314、324、;近距離的檢測區(qū)域。
【具體實施方式】
[0036]